## Deploying the Gatewick Proctor Queue

Deploys are pretty painless: push to main, wait for the pipeline, then watch the queue drain dashboard for five minutes. If candidates pile up mid-exam, roll back first and ask questions later — the queue replays safely. Everything the workers care about lives in one config block, shown here for reference.

settings of bafof-yagef:
JOROX_PIN=8740
JOROX_TENANT=pelox
JOROX_METRICS_HOST=metrics.jorox.qorvelworks.internal
JOROX_SEAL=seal_c78f63c1
JOROX_STANDBY_TEAM=norax

**Ticket: Expired creds blocking stale-cache postmortem follow-ups**

Hey team — the cleanup job from the Mossvale stale-cache postmortem stopped running because its credential expired last Friday. That's why a few customers are still seeing old pricing pages. Until the permanent fix ships, you can purge affected entries manually using the key below.

service key, fawip-bajef: kto11_Qt5wZK9vdNC

Deploy step 6 — Frostmark tile cache. Stop the cache writers. Flush the warm set only; cold shards stay. Push the new render binary, then verify checksum against the release manifest. Before restart, the cache layer needs its upstream auth refreshed or every render request 401s. Edit /srv/frostmark/cache.env and insert the credential as the line below.

vault entry, yahif-yajep: COURIER_KEY29=b802bdf8034096b65a51c6ba5abe2